WebGiven an independent variable x and a dependent variable y, y is directly proportional to x if there is a non-zero constant k such that =. The relation is often denoted using the symbols "∝" (not to be confused with the Greek letter alpha) or "~": , or . For the proportionality constant can be expressed as the ratio =. WebIn Maths, inverse variation is the relationships between variables that are represented in the form of y = k/x, where x and y are two variables and k is the constant value. WebMay 25, 2024 · The main idea in inverse variation is that as one variable increases the other variable decreases, which means that if x is increasing y is decreasing, and if x is decreasing y is increasing. WebThe formula for indirect variation The general equation of indirect variation is Y = K× (1/X) or K = XY. Here K is the proportionality constant. The variable X is inversely proportional to another variable Y when Y varies as a reciprocal of X. Therefore if Y is inversely proportional to X, we can write Y × (1/X) or Y= K × (1/X). WebNov 9, 2015 · Let me give you a different example: If y varies inversely as X find the constant of variation K and the inverse variation equation for the solution y=1/2 when X=44. XY= K Just substitute the values into the equation: 44(1/2)=K 44/2=22=K, so rewrite the XY=K to the following: Y=K/x Y=22/X , and you are done.
